Che cos'è la compatibilità delle applicazioni?
"Compatibilità delle applicazioni" è un termine usato per descrivere il processo per determinare se un determinato prodotto software funzionerà correttamente con un determinato hardware. In genere, questo processo determinerà anche se due diversi prodotti software interagiranno, consentendo lo scambio di dati per il completamento di attività specifiche. In molti casi, le utilità del programma sono rese disponibili per un facile download in modo che gli utenti finali possano determinare il livello di compatibilità esistente tra diverse combinazioni di hardware e software.
Le utility scaricabili offerte con sistemi diversi varieranno leggermente in termini di tipo di compatibilità delle applicazioni che può essere verificata. La maggior parte analizzerà il software che è attualmente caricato su un disco rigido e determinerà sia i punti di compatibilità che eventuali problemi che potrebbero ostacolare il libero trasferimento dei dati a ciascuna applicazione. Uno strumento simile viene utilizzato dagli sviluppatori di software per determinare se il software attualmente in fase di sviluppo funzionerà alla massima efficienza con determinati dispositivi hardware e funzionerà su specifici sistemi operativi senza difficoltà. L'uso di queste utilità può essere importante quando si tratta di progettare un nuovo prodotto che interagirà con gli attuali prodotti software e hardware popolari o determinare se una determinata applicazione si interfaccia perfettamente con software e hardware già in uso.
La compatibilità delle applicazioni è anche una preoccupazione quando si tratta di estrarre e utilizzare dati da diversi prodotti software. Ad esempio, un responsabile delle vendite che desidera acquistare un nuovo programma che consenta ai venditori di tenere traccia dei contatti dei clienti e generare lettere dai dati acquisiti vorrebbe assicurarsi che il database delle vendite sia compatibile con il software di elaborazione testi attualmente utilizzato dal team. Allo stesso tempo, il responsabile delle vendite vorrebbe che il database fosse in grado di ricevere dati da un foglio di calcolo o altro formato e di organizzare le informazioni in singoli file dei clienti all'interno del database. A meno che non esista il livello di compatibilità dell'applicazione per consentire l'interazione desiderata, il database è di scarsa utilità per il team di vendita.
Mentre la confezione di molti prodotti elenca i requisiti software e hardware necessari per far funzionare i prodotti in piena efficienza, a volte è ancora necessario che gli utenti finali effettuino un controllo di compatibilità delle applicazioni. Ciò è particolarmente vero quando le informazioni fornite dal produttore non sono chiare riguardo alla capacità del prodotto di interagire con un tipo di freeware che l'utente finale utilizza attualmente. A tal fine, esistono numerosi kit di strumenti di compatibilità online gratuiti ea pagamento che possono essere scaricati e utilizzati per determinare il livello di compatibilità tra due o più prodotti software o hardware.